Barrel Roll after the first Mag-lock section. It has a small jump. Pretty easy to do it even in venom.

Stardragon88
9th February 2008, 06:35 PM
If you have a boost, use it just before you fly off that huge jump. Your momentum will carry you all the way past the finish line, the corner, and into the straight section on the left. Allows you to do a BR easily as you can line your ship up with the track after the corner and not worry about smashing into it had you landed (and gotten the BR boost) before the corner.

It's a little bit like that jump at the end of Modesto Heights in Pure.

I have taken all tips to practise but I can not come up with a lower laptime then 24.00 for this track.

DjManiac; you did an amazing 23.19 with a Feisar, superb man, but how on earth did you do that?

From the huge jump I took my turbo together with a BR to be able to land after the finishline in the left corner. The boost given by the BR in the new lap is giving you enough speed and height to do another BR now I took the long right curve up and hit everyspeed pad on the way, also through the 180 hitting every speedpad. Airbrake a little to the right to enter the Magstrip with a BR over the small jump. The long sweeping right curve up and then hit the boost to the finishline.

This is how I did it. I think i miss somthing here, but I don't know what?
